Biography
Dr Meena Okera graduated with Honours from the University of Adelaide in 2001. She began her specialist training at the Royal Adelaide Hospital, completing it at Guys and St Thomas’ Hospital in London. She practiced as a consultant medical oncologist at the Royal Darwin Hospital and Alice Springs Hospital and was involved in a number of key service development projects for cancer care in the Northern Territory. Her clinical interests include treating solid tumours, in particular breast and gynaecological malignancies, as well as providing supportive and survivorship care.
